== Cebuano ==
=== Etymology ===
From English yo-yo / yoyo. Formerly a trademark. Most likely from Ilocano yóyo.
=== Pronunciation ===
Hyphenation: yo‧yo
=== Noun ===
yoyo
a yo-yo; a toy consisting of a spheroidal or cylindrical spindle having a circular groove in which string is wound; it is used by holding the string in the fingers and reeling the spindle up and down by movements of the wrist
a cake that is shaped like a yoyo, akin to a cookie sandwich, often purple and with a margarine filling and rolled in white sugar
=== Verb ===
yoyo
to play with a yo-yo
